Pandemic compounded care issues.

Let me preface my remarks by saying that the pandemic made operating of any of these assisted living places difficult. There was instances of long wait times & mom hesitated to press her button for any small thing: she starting doing most everything herself, including the bathroom, which is a liability issue. Mom was at a 3rd level of care, but rate should have been adjusted as she became more self sufficient; a reappraisal was not done. Expired food was found on shelves & in her mini fridge. Laundry was not sorted (whites got dingy from mixed loads), food in dining room was not geared towards senior's diets (onions, cruciferous vegs like broccoli that are hard to digest). They did help with a GF diet. Mom moved out with another person's meds; Mom had side effects from taking wrong meds for 10 days. Medtechs are basically kids dispensing meds. Upon moving out, it was found that 227. in items were missing, though things were marked. We are owed pro rata rent of 2.7+K 10 wks later.

Don't Believe The Billboard About Prestige Pines of Dewitt!

My father was put into Prestige Pines by his legal guardian. The facility evidently has been honored for it's care. In the nearly two years that my father was a resident I failed in figuring out why. My father was there for two weeks before I realized that he had not been put on the bathing schedule. I had to ask for his bedding to be changed and his room to be cleaned constantly. The administration was severely lacking in knowledge and in compassion. I was never happy with actions, or lack thereof. The aides were not allowed to come on the premises if they weren't working. This meant while they were off work a resident would pass away and they weren't even notified or allowed to say good bye. Those people would sometimes come back to work and find an empty bed. This is just not right for the aides or the residents. Sometimes the residents don't have anyone but those aides loving them. The employees were not required to have any previous training. The med techs and aides were very caring to my dad and to me. But the thought of their only training being from someone else who was not formally trained was very disturbing. My dad had Parkinson's Disease, acute back pain, and type II diabetes. He fell numerous times and was allowed to eat anything his friend brought into the facility for him to snack on. There was very little encouragement for exercise or sunshine other than one monthly excursion. Even the games, church, and gatherings are only slightly mentioned to residents. I would have thought that encouragement to engage the residents would have been the norm rather than sitting them in front of a TV or letting them lay in bed not knowing if it is morning or night. I understand that residents passing away is a common occurrence but is a card too much to expect after two years of residency? I realize that this facility is not for the rich although many thousands of dollars were recently been spent to update the furniture and artwork in the common areas. I would have thought the emphasis and use of money would be elsewhere. Even the entrance was dangerous with constant dripping water and ice build up. I know that everyone cannot be watched at all times. This facility only had two aides for the assisted living building of almost 20 residents. The memory section had three or four aides. I suggest requiring more training, hiring more people, and paying better wages. Our parents are worth it!
